About Grid Games
For the past 28 years The Grid Games has served the Connecticut gaming community. We hold daily gaming tournaments and carry a full line of CCG's, Board Games, Video Games, RPG's and gaming accessories.

What Is the Cost of Living Near Manchester?

Understanding the cost of living near Manchester is key to truly evaluating a salary offer or your current compensation at Grid Games.
Manchester's Cost of Living Index is approximately 102.5 (2.5% more expensive than US average; 4.8% less than CT average). Hartford suburb, more affordable housing than West Hartford/Fairfield Co.
